Dictionary Results for occasion
1. occasion - noun · an event that occurs at a critical time; "at such junctures he always had an impulse to leave"; "it was needed only on special occasions" Synonym(s): juncture Hypernym(s): happening, occurrence, occurrent, natural_event
2. occasion - noun · a vaguely specified social event; "the party was quite an affair"; "an occasion arranged to honor the president"; "a seemingly endless round of social functions" Synonym(s): affair, social_occasion, function, social_function Hypernym(s): social_event
3. occasion - noun · reason; "there was no occasion for complaint" Hypernym(s): reason, ground
4. occasion - noun · the time of a particular event; "on the occasion of his 60th birthday" Hypernym(s): time
5. occasion - noun · an opportunity to do something; "there was never an occasion for her to demonstrate her skill" Hypernym(s): opportunity, chance
6. occasion - verb · give occasion to Hypernym(s): cause, do, make
